Participate in the HEAR 2021 NeurIPS Challenge (Holistic Evaluation of Audio Representations)
SUMMARY:
- HEAR 2021 challenges you to develop a general-purpose audio representation that provides a strong basis for learning in a wide variety of tasks and scenarios.
- We will evaluate audio representations using a benchmark suite of secret tasks across a variety of domains, including speech, environmental sound, and music.
- You can submit an existing published model, or new work.
- You have until October 31st 2021 to submit to the challenge.
- PMLR will publish a HEAR special issue. All HEAR participants are invited to submit in January 2022.
